Microsoft.Dynamics.Retail.SharePoint.Web.Services.ViewModel Namespace

Important

This content is archived and is not being updated. For the latest documentation, see Microsoft Dynamics 365 product documentation. For the latest release plans, see Dynamics 365 and Microsoft Power Platform release plans.

Classes

  Class Description
Public class Address The address view model representation.
Public class AddressCollectionResponse Response object containing the collection of addresses.
Public class BooleanResponse Boolean response class.
Public class CreateSalesOrderResponse Sales Order response class for creation of a new order.
Public class Customer Customer view model class.
Public class CustomerResponse Customer response class.
Public class DeliveryMethod View model for the delivery method.
Public class DeliveryMethodsResponse Delivery methods response class.
Public class DemoServiceResponse Demo view response.
Public class GiftCardInformation Gift Card view model class.
Public class GiftCardResponse Gift card response.
Public class ItemDeliveryMethods A single delivery methods view model representation. (FEDEX, UPS, etc).
Public class ItemShippingOptions A single shipping option view model representation. (Pick up from store, ship to me, etc)
Public class KitComponentInfo Represents the view model for a kit component.
Public class KitComponentVariantResponse Information for a specific kit configuration.
Public class KitConfigurationInformation Information for a specific kit configuration.
Public class KitConfigurationResponse Information for a specific kit configuration.
Public class KitLine Encapsulates information for a kit line.
Public class Listing Represents the data model for a listing.
Public class ListingAvailableQuantity View model for the available quantities of a listing.
Public class ListingAvailableQuantityResponse Encapsulates quantities available of specific listings.
Public class ListingPrice Container for the price of an item.
Public class ListingPriceResponse Listing price response.
Public class LoyaltyCard Presents a loyalty card.
Public class LoyaltyCardResponse Loyalty Card response class.
Public class LoyaltyCardsResponse Response object containing the collection of loyalty cards.
Public class LoyaltyCardTier Presents a loyalty card tier. A loyalty card may belong to a loyalty group (i.e. the default loyalty tier), or a specific loyalty tier.
Public class LoyaltyCardTransaction Presents a loyalty card.
Public class LoyaltyCardTransactionsResponse Response object containing the collection of loyalty cards.
Public class LoyaltyGroup Presents a loyalty group which may or may not contain a list of loyalty tiers.
Public class LoyaltyRewardPoint Presents a loyalty card.
Public class LoyaltyTier Presents a loyalty tier.
Public class NullResponse Null response class representing successful round trip of service call but no returned data.
Public class Payment The payment view model representation.
Public class PaymentCardResponse Payment card response.
Public class PaymentCardType Payment card types.
Public class PaymentCardTypesResponse Payment card types response.
Public class ResponseError Response error class.
Public class SalesOrder Represents a completed sales order and its details.
Public class SalesOrderCollectionResponse Collection of sales order response class.
Public class SalesOrderItem The sales order item view model representation.
Public class SalesOrderResponse Sales Order response class.
Public class SelectedItemShippingOptions Represents a the selected shipping options for an line item.
Public class SelectedOrderShippingOptions Represents a the selected shipping options for an order.
Public class SelectedShippingOptions Represents a the selected shipping options for an order.
Public class ServiceResponse Service response class.
Public class ShippingOption A single shipping option view model representation.
Public class ShippingOptionResponse Shipping option response class.
Public class ShippingOptions Represents the available shipping options to choose from for an order or each line item.
Public class ShoppingCart The shopping cart view model representation.
Public class ShoppingCartCollectionResponse Collection of shopping carts response class.
Public class ShoppingCartItem The shopping cart item view model representation.
Public class ShoppingCartResponse Shopping cart response class.
Public class StoreAddress The store address view model representation.
Public class StorefrontListItem Encapsulates information for a storefront list item.
Public class StoreLocation Represents a store location
Public class StoreLocationResponse Store location response.
Public class StoreProductAvailability Represents a store product availability.
Public class StoreProductAvailabilityItem An item available in a store.
Public class StoreProductAvailabilityResponse Store product availability response.
Public class TenderDataLine The payment view model representation.
Public class Transaction The transaction view model representation.
Public class TransactionItem The transaction item view model representation.
Public class WishList Wish list view model representation.
Public class WishListCollectionResponse Collection of wish list response class.
Public class WishListLine Represents a wish list line.
Public class WishListResponse Wish list response class.

Enumerations

  Enumeration Description
Public enumeration AddressType Customer Address Type. These should stay in sync w/the DM enum and AX.
Public enumeration CartType Represents the shopping cart type.
Public enumeration DayMonthYear Represents the time unit.
Public enumeration LoyaltyCardTenderType Describes the tender type of the loyalty card.
Public enumeration LoyaltyRewardPointEntryType Describes the entry type of the loyalty reward point line.
Public enumeration LoyaltyRewardPointType Describes the unit type of the loyalty reward point.
Public enumeration LoyaltyRewardType Describes the type of the loyalty reward.
Public enumeration ShoppingCartDataLevel Represents the level of information contained in shopping cart entity in storefront.
Public enumeration ShoppingCartItemType Represents the shopping cart item type.